Onuachu shines in Genk’s win over Cercle Brugge

Super Eagles giant striker Paul Onuachu played all 90 minutes in Gent slim win over Cercle Brugge in a Belgian league clash on Saturday.

 

The Belgian champions had to dig deep in the game to grind out victory against their visitors.

 

Onuachu was harmful for the visitors’ defence but was unable to get the better of the goalkeeper who stood firm to deny him and others.

 

The crowd at Litmus Arena did witness a goal, although it was only in the 8th when Sebastien Dewaest scored the only goal of the game.

 

While Onuachu was on for the entire duration of the game, Genk’s last UEFA Champions League goal scorer Stephen Odey was among the unused substitutes.

 

Odey enjoyed plaudits after his maiden Champions League goal against Liverpool last Wednesday, but it was not enough to convince Felice Mazzu to give him some minutes of action on Saturday.
